Statistics on new Years Resolutions

Heading into a new year brings about the promise of a fresh start with excitement. Excitement that often lags within the first three months of the new year.

Statistics show that less than 25% of people actually stay committed to their goals thirty days in and only about 8% accomplish their goals.

This made me think that there has got to be a better way to accomplish things and awakening your creativity in the new year.

Instead of the normal goals of losing weight, working out and eating healthier, which are amazing things to incorporate into everyday living, approach the new year with an adventurous spirit.

Facing a fear for personal awakening

Facing fears can help you become unstuck while bringing about more awareness in your every day.

Often times we are so grounded in our everyday routines of life that we are just going through the motions.

Just like when you drive the same route to work everyday, some days you arrive not remembering driving there.

We are simply sleep walking through our busy, noisy lives.

This can make it very difficult to remain committed to new goals or any goals for that matter.

In order to achieve new goals or awaken our motivation and creativity, we need to become more aware.

Create new experiences for reviving creativity

By welcoming new things you awaken yourself and your senses. Creating unique experiences has some great benefits:

  • overcome fear
  • get to know yourself better
  • learn new skills
  • stimulate creativity
  • get yourself unstuck

In a sense, facing a fear or experiencing something new and different takes us out of our comfort zone and in a sense brings our senses back to life.
